Trump Admin Tells Court: Let OpenAI Rip Off The Intercept’s Articles
Source ↗ 👁 0 💬 0
President Donald Trump’s Justice Department took the side of tech giant OpenAI in its court battle with The Intercept and other media companies over the company’s use of others’ creative work to train its artificial intelligence tools.
